Legal and Future Care Planning for Your Relative with a Developmental Disability - Theresa M. Varnet, MSW, JD

From The Arc of Illinois and hosted by The Arc of Winnebago, Boone & Ogle Counties. This workshop will address the unique needs that families have in planning for the financial and legal future of their relative with a developmental disability. Topics will include: Negotiating the Social Security Maze; Preserving Eligibility for Government Benefits through Proper Estate Planning; Special Needs Trusts; Guardianship and Less Restrictive Alternatives- The Implications for Consent; Health Care Proxies (Advance Directives); and Selecting a Knowledgeable Attorney. Presented by Theresa M. Varnet, M.S.W., J.D. Terrie has been an advocate for persons with disabilities for over 40 years. In addition to being a certified teacher, licensed social worker and graduate of the DePaul University College of Law, she is the parent of an adult daughter with a disability. Her experiences include work in the area of in-service training of families, special educators and other professionals. She specializes in probate and estate planning for people with disabilities.
